

Elixir Mentor
Jacob Luetzow
Welcome to the Elixir Mentor Podcast, your go-to source for All Things Elixir. This show digs into the heart of the Elixir community, featuring interviews with enthusiasts and pioneers who share their stories and innovative projects that define our ecosystem. Each episode explores groundbreaking libraries and boundary-pushing applications shaping Elixir's future. We discuss best practices, emerging trends, and the latest tools and techniques. Perfect for developers at any stage of their Elixir journey, providing insights and inspiration. Join me as we explore the world of Elixir together.
Episodes
Mentioned books

21 snips
Apr 6, 2024 • 1h 8min
Wout De Puysseleir on Svelte inside Phoenix LiveView
Wout De Puysseleir, a full-stack dev behind LiveSvelte who works with Elixir, Phoenix and Svelte. He explains why he built LiveSvelte to add client interactivity to LiveView. They cover end-to-end reactivity, how LiveSvelte maps props to LiveView assigns, slot interoperability challenges, deployment/build needs, and demos like a multiplayer game and PWA use cases.

Mar 30, 2024 • 1h 10min
Benjamin Schultzer on Real-time Database Observability
In this episode of the Elixir Mentor Podcast, your go-to source for All Things Elixir, I'm thrilled to welcome Benjamin Schultzer, a Senior Engineer who is building a real-time database observability tool for Ecto and Phoenix LiveView. 🔍💡
Benjamin will share his insights into the challenges developers face when working with databases in Elixir applications and showcase his solution. We'll explore how his tool integrates seamlessly with Ecto to provide developers with valuable insights into query performance, database connections, and potential bottlenecks.
We'll also dive into the world of Phoenix LiveView and discover how Benjamin's real-time observability tool enhances the development experience by monitoring and optimizing database interactions triggered by LiveView events. 📊⚡🌐💻
Join us for an insightful conversation that will enhance your approach to database optimization and empower you to build performant and scalable applications. 🚀💡
#ElixirMentor #DatabaseObservability #RealTimeMonitoring #EctoOptimization #PhoenixLiveView #PerformanceTuning #DeveloperTools
Connect with Benjamin:
X: Follow Benjamin on X (Twitter)
DB Visor: Explore DB Visor
SUPPORT ELIXIR MENTOR
🌐 My website: Visit Elixir Mentor Website
🎙 Check out my podcast: Listen to Hired Gun Apps Podcast
🆘 NEED HELP?? Join our Discord Server
🔗 All my Links: Connect with Jacob on Linktree
Join this channel to get access to perks: YouTube Channel Membership

Mar 24, 2024 • 1h 4min
Peter Ullrich on Elixir and Online Course Creation
In this episode of the Elixir Mentor Podcast, your go-to source for All Things Elixir, I sit down with Peter Ullrich, a Senior Elixir developer, PragProg Author, Public Speaker, and Blogger. 🚀
We'll explore his unique journey from psychology to software development and discuss his passion for Software Architecture, Product Engineering, and knowledge sharing. Discover how Peter's background in psychology influences his approach to coding and learn about his experience as a founder of "Indie Courses."
We'll explore the challenges of creating and selling video courses and how Indie Courses help creators succeed in the competitive online education market. Don't miss this opportunity to gain insights from a multifaceted expert in the Elixir community and learn how to monetize your knowledge effectively.
Join us for an inspiring conversation! 🎙️
#ElixirMentor #SoftwareDevelopment #ProductEngineering #OnlineEducation #Entrepreneurship #VideoCourseSales #KnowledgeSharing #TechCommunity
Connect with Peter:
Indie Courses: Explore Indie Courses
X: Follow Peter on X (Twitter)
Website: Visit Peter's Website
SUPPORT ELIXIR MENTOR
🌐 My website: Visit Elixir Mentor Website
🎙 Check out my podcast: Listen to Hired Gun Apps Podcast
🆘 NEED HELP?? Join our Discord Server
🔗 All my Links: Connect with Jacob on Linktree
Join this channel to get access to perks: YouTube Channel Membership

Mar 16, 2024 • 57min
Michael Frew on the Tech Acquisition Blueprint
In this episode of the Elixir Mentor Podcast, your go-to source for All Things Elixir, I sit down with Michael Frew, an online business acquisitions expert. 🚀
We'll dive into his journey from corporate consulting to acquiring online companies, including Gigalixir, Elixir's Platform as a Service. Discover why IT professionals should consider buying instead of starting businesses, and learn about Michael's 8-step framework for acquiring online companies.
We'll discuss the advantages of investing in online businesses, particularly in the Elixir ecosystem, and explore the future of Gigalixir. Don't miss this chance to gain valuable insights into online business acquisitions and the Elixir ecosystem.
Join us for an engaging discussion! 🎙️
#ElixirMentor #DigitalBusiness #OnlineAcquisitions #CareerShift #Entrepreneurship #TechIndustry #BusinessOperations #TechCommunity
Connect with Michael:
X: Follow Michael on X (Twitter)
Website: Visit Michael's Website
SUPPORT ELIXIR MENTOR
🌐 My website: Visit Elixir Mentor Website
🎙 Check out my podcast: Listen to Hired Gun Apps Podcast
🆘 NEED HELP?? Join our Discord Server
🔗 All my Links: Connect with Jacob on Linktree
Join this channel to get access to perks: YouTube Channel Membership

Feb 24, 2024 • 57min
Roman Kotov on Creative Tech Solutions
In this episode of the Elixir Mentor Podcast, your go-to source for All Things Elixir, I sit down with Roman Kotov, a trailblazer in custom smart home solutions.
We'll unravel the story behind Exshome, Roman's platform that's redefining the boundaries of smart homes by enabling enthusiasts to create their personalized setups. From using old USB webcams and Raspberry Pis to crafting unique CCTV solutions, we'll explore how Exshome empowers you to bring your unused gadgets back to life.
Our discussion will cover:
The challenges of traditional smart home systems
The technical foundations of Exshome, including its use of Elixir and LiveView
What the future holds for smart home enthusiasts looking to break free from off-the-shelf limitations
Roman's other innovative projects, showcasing his contributions to the tech community
Whether you're a smart home hobbyist, an Elixir developer, or just love tech innovation, this session is packed with insights you won't want to miss. Gear up for an engaging chat that will inspire you to think differently about smart home technology. Catch you there!
#ElixirMentor #SmartHome #Exshome #Elixir #LiveView #TechInnovation #HomeAutomation #DIYTech #SoftwareDevelopment #ProgrammingCommunity
Connect with Roman:
X: Follow Roman on X (Twitter)
Website: Visit Roman's Website
Github: Explore Exshome on GitHub
SUPPORT ELIXIR MENTOR
🌐 My website: Visit Elixir Mentor Website
🎙 Check out my podcast: Listen to Hired Gun Apps Podcast
🆘 NEED HELP?? Join our Discord Server
🔗 All my Links: Connect with Jacob on Linktree
Join this channel to get access to perks: YouTube Channel Membership

10 snips
Feb 17, 2024 • 47min
Gustavo Oliveira on Tailwind in Phoenix
Gustavo Oliveira, a full-stack Elixir educator and creator behind ELXPRO and a YouTube channel. He talks about Tailwind becoming default in Phoenix 1.7 and why that simplifies setup. Short takes on common Tailwind pitfalls, layout strategies for LiveView, reusable function components, and tooling like Tailwind IntelliSense. Practical tips for learning Flexbox and Grid and avoiding blind copy-paste.

29 snips
Feb 10, 2024 • 1h 7min
Andrew Stewart on LiveView the Do’s and Don’ts
In this engaging conversation, Andrew Stewart, an Elixir developer and educator known for his insightful YouTube content, shares his journey from Ruby to Elixir. He dives into the do’s and don’ts of LiveView, emphasizing its learning curve and best practices for building real-time applications. Andrew highlights the importance of using JS hooks wisely, warns against overusing server roundtrips, and discusses the challenges of handling multiple LiveViews. He also reflects on the ethics of user tracking and the evolving job market in the Elixir community.

Feb 5, 2024 • 57min
Thomas Millar on Machine Learning & Elixir
Thomas Millar, a software engineer specializing in machine learning and data engineering and creator of instructor_ex, talks about bridging Elixir with AI. He covers structured prompting and mapping LLM outputs to Ecto schemas. The conversation explores running models in Elixir, streaming partial JSON hydration, and practical projects for getting started.

8 snips
Feb 4, 2024 • 38min
Michael Lubas on Securing Elixir
Michael Lubas, founder of Paraxial.io and a cybersecurity pro with penetration testing and product security roots. He discusses securing Elixir and Phoenix apps using bot defense, runtime tracing, and developer-friendly tooling. Talks cover asset management, fast native Elixir integration, detection of credential-stuffing, and common Elixir pitfalls like unsafe deserialization and backend auth enforcement.


